ASEAN Foreign Ministers statement on Thailand-Cambodia border dispute
ASEAN backs efforts by its Chair to facilitate dialogue and restore peace based on unity and good neighborly relations. - FB/ASEAN
WE are deeply concerned over the escalation between the Kingdom of Thailand and the Kingdom of Cambodia which have resulted in increasing number of casualties on both sides and destruction of public properties, as well as displacement of a large number of people along the border areas.
We emphasise the need for both sides to exercise maximum restraint and undertake an immediate ceasefire, and refrain from taking any actions that may undermine it. We further urge both sides to return to the negotiating table and to resolve the dispute in accordance with international law and the peaceful settlement of disputes to restore peace and stability based on the spirit of ASEAN family, unity and good neighborliness.
We remain seized of the issue and support the efforts of the ASEAN Chair through its good offices in facilitating both sides to resume peaceful dialogue and end the fighting.

The press statement is issued by ASEAN Foreign Ministers
